| Allergies??? we have a new 13week old yorkie to our family. We have never owned a new puppy and this is a new experience. Our little baby boy has like a cough/sneezing thing going on. My husband took him to the vet and he said it was due to him having shots the day before that was a week ago and sometime he has a little discharge coming out of his eye like mucous. He only does his coughing/sneezing when he has been sleeping or is outside. My vet doesn't seems concerned. Is this normal??? |

| Coughing and Sneezing Carib started to make a "honking" kind of sound - like he had a fur ball. From what I have read, Yorkies tend to "reverse sneeze". They stand erect with head jutted out, eyes open, and legs somewhat bowl-legged. If you rub their throat and make them swallow, the noise stops. If your Yorkie has any kind of raspy cough - take them to the vet immediately as this could be a sign of a collapsing trachea which this breed is prone to. Also, make sure to have them in a harness versus a regular dog collar!
